What is Murphy Oil's non-controlling interests?
Murphy Oil (MUR) reported non-controlling interests of $133.98M in Q1 2026.
How has Murphy Oil's non-controlling interests changed year-over-year?
Murphy Oil's non-controlling interests decreased by 14.7% year-over-year, from $157.02M to $133.98M.
What is the long-term trend for Murphy Oil's non-controlling interests?
Over 5 years (2020 to 2025), Murphy Oil's non-controlling interests has grown at a -8.0%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$179.81M to $118.32M.
What does non-controlling interests mean?
Equity attributable to minority shareholders in subsidiaries not fully owned by the parent — their proportional claim on subsidiary net assets.
